What’s Inside the 2000 Isuzu Trooper Alternator? (In Simple Terms)

Let’s break down the parts you’ll see in the exploded view.

1. Alternator Housing

This is the outer shell—usually aluminum. It keeps everything protected and helps with cooling. The housing comes apart in two halves, front and rear.

2. Rotor Assembly

This spins inside the alternator and is responsible for creating the magnetic field needed to generate electricity. When I first opened mine, the rotor was the last thing I wanted to touch because it looked intimidating. Turns out, it just lifts straight out once the case is open.

3. Stator

This is the ring of copper windings surrounding the rotor. It doesn’t move, but it’s essential in generating AC current. If your alternator is completely fried, this is one of the parts that may need replacing.

4. Voltage Regulator

This little guy ensures your battery doesn’t get overcharged or undercharged. Think of it as the alternator’s “brain.” When my Trooper wouldn’t keep the battery charged, this was the final part I replaced before deciding to swap the whole alternator.

5. Rectifier (Diode Assembly)

The alternator produces AC power, but your SUV needs DC. The rectifier handles that conversion. If your lights flicker or your voltmeter jumps around, this may be the culprit.

6. Brushes & Brush Holder

Brushes deliver current to the rotor. They wear down over time—I’ve replaced this part in more than one vehicle. If your alternator is weak but not completely dead, brushes are an inexpensive fix.

7. Bearings

These let the rotor spin smoothly. If you hear whining or squealing under the hood, worn bearings might be to blame.

My Personal Tips for Tackling the Job

Tip #1: Take Photos Before Removing Anything

I learned this the hard way. When you’re reassembling the alternator, it’s amazing how quickly your brain forgets which bolt went where. Smartphone photos saved me more than once.

Tip #2: Don’t Skip Testing the Voltage Regulator

If your alternator isn’t charging properly, the regulator is often the problem. On my Trooper, everything looked fine until I tested the regulator. Only then did I discover it was sending inconsistent voltage.

Step-by-Step: Using the Exploded View to Your Advantage

1. Study the Diagram First

Take a minute to look at how everything is organized. The alternator may look complicated, but it’s just layers stacked neatly.

2. Label Your Parts

I like using sandwich bags or small containers. Write labels like front housing bolts, brush assembly, or bearing shims.

3. Remove in Order Shown

The exploded view shows the order of disassembly. Follow that order. It prevents accidental damage.

4. Compare Parts as You Go

Whenever a component looks worn or burnt, inspect it closely with the diagram in mind. Sometimes the difference is subtle.

5. Reassemble Slowly

If something doesn’t fit easily, it probably isn’t aligned right. The exploded view makes it easier to see the correct orientation.

When You Should Replace the Whole Alternator Instead of Repairing It

There’s no shame in replacing the entire unit. I’ve done it. In fact, for the 2000 Isuzu Trooper, replacement is sometimes cheaper and faster than rebuilding.

Consider replacing it if:

  • The stator or rotor is burned

  • The alternator housing is cracked

  • Multiple internal components have failed

  • You don’t have time for a full teardown

  • The alternator has 150k+ miles on it

Sometimes peace of mind is worth the extra cost.
